Death of The Rt Revd Donald Caird

Tribute from the Archbishop of Armagh

The Rt Revd Prof Donald Caird, former Archbishop of Dublin (1985–96), Bishop of Meath & Kildare (1976–85) and Bishop of Limerick (1970–76) has died during the early hours of Thursday 1st June (aged 91).

The Most Revd Dr Richard Clarke, Archbishop of Armagh and Primate of All Ireland, has paid the following tribute:

‘So many will be saddened by the news of the death of Bishop Donald Caird, who all will recognise gave wonderful service to the Church of Ireland in so many ways over very many years.

‘Donald was loved and respected in equal measure and I wish to extend the sympathies of the Church of Ireland to Nancy and his family. May they know God’s comfort at this time of loss.’

Funeral arrangements will be confirmed in due course.
